The Legend of Apsara Dance

The Apsara dance is inspired by the celestial maidens of Hindu and Khmer mythology, known for their extraordinary beauty and divine grace. According to legend, the Apsaras descended from heaven to perform a sacred dance, thereby securing the gods’ victory over the demons in a quest for the elixir of immortality. This mythological narrative is beautifully translated into a dance form that embodies the elegance and spirituality of the celestial beings.

The Artistic Elements of Apsara Dance

Apsara dance is characterized by its intricate choreography, expressive hand gestures (mudras), and the elaborate costumes and makeup of the dancers. The costumes, heavily influenced by the depictions found in the temples of Angkor, are a sight to behold. They typically include a silk sampot (a traditional skirt), a beaded belt, and a richly decorated top, complemented by ornate jewelry and the famous Apsara crown.

The dancers’ faces are painted with traditional makeup, featuring bold eyes and lips, and sometimes decorated with elaborate facial tattoos that mimic the carvings found on temple walls. The most distinctive feature of the Apsara dance is the dancers’ hand gestures, which are not only aesthetically pleasing but also convey specific meanings and narratives.

The History of Batik in Indonesia

The origins of Batik in Indonesia can be traced back centuries, with evidence suggesting its existence in the country since the 12th century. The art form flourished in the courts of Central Java and Yogyakarta, where it became a symbol of nobility and royalty. Over time, Batik spread across the archipelago, evolving in different regions to reflect local tastes, traditions, and techniques. Today, various styles of Batik can be found across Indonesia, each with its unique patterns and colors, reflecting the diversity of the Indonesian culture.

The Making of Batik: A Traditional Process

The process of creating Batik is both an art and a science. It involves drawing intricate designs on fabric using a tool called a canting, which is a small pen-like instrument with a metal tip for applying melted wax. The wax acts as a resist, preventing the dye from penetrating the fabric in certain areas. After the wax is applied, the fabric is dyed, often multiple times to achieve the desired colors and patterns. Once the dyeing is complete, the fabric is boiled to remove the wax, revealing the final design. This process requires a high level of skill, patience, and creativity, making each Batik piece a unique work of art.

Regional Styles of Indonesian Batik

Indonesia’s vast archipelago has given rise to a variety of Batik styles, each reflecting the local culture and traditions. Some of the most renowned styles include the intricate and symmetrical patterns of Javanese Batik, the bold and colorful designs of Balinese Batik, and the geometric motifs of Batak Batik from North Sumatra. Each style tells a story of its region’s history, beliefs, and artistic vision.
